Job Overview We are seeking a highly motivated and detail-oriented Electrical Technician to join our team. In this role, you will be responsible for maintaining, troubleshooting, and repairing electrical systems and equipment across the Residential, Commercial and Industrial fields. This position offers an exciting opportunity to work with cutting-edge technology, automation systems, and electrical schematics, while applying your mechanical knowledge and scripting skills. If you thrive in a fast-paced environment where problem-solving and technical precision are valued, this is the perfect role for you! Responsibilities Install, maintain, and repair electrical wiring, systems, and equipment using hand tools and surface mount technology techniques. Conduct analysis to identify issues within electrical systems and implement effective solutions promptly. Read and interpret schematics, wiring diagrams, and technical drawings created with CAD software such as AutoCAD. Perform debugging of electical circuits . Utilize testing tools such as ohmmeters and multimeters to diagnose electrical faults accurately. Support project scheduling activities by coordinating maintenance tasks and equipment upgrades efficiently. Conduct equipment repair, preventive maintenance, and troubleshooting on electrical systems. Install Residential, Commercial and Industrial circuits and hardware. Ensure compliance with NEC (National Electrical Code) standards and safety protocols during all repairs and installations. Proven experience working with electrical systems in manufacturing, industrial and Residential environments. Strong knowledge of electrical wiring practices. Hands-on experience with surface mount technology (SMT), soldering techniques, and electronic assembly processes. Familiarity with programmable logic controllers (PLCs) and automation systems. Ability to perform root cause analysis on complex electrical issues efficiently. Mechanical knowledge related to equipment repair and maintenance is desirable. Experience working with NEC standards, electrical wiring codes, and safety regulations in industrial settings. Competence in using hand tools, testing instruments like ohmmeters, and conducting surface mount component assembly.
